Microbial surface mannose-containing carbohydrates, including mannans and high-mannose glycans, are critical structural components and Pathogen-Associated Molecular Patterns (PAMPs) found on the surfaces of bacteria, fungi, and viruses (Source: NCBI, PMC4226534). These glycans serve as essential recognition sites for the host's innate immune system through Pattern Recognition Receptors (PRRs) such as Mannose-Binding Lectin (MBL) and Dectin-2 (Source: PubMed, 21513771). In fungi like Candida albicans, mannans are major constituents of the cell wall, while in viruses like HIV-1 and SARS-CoV-2, high-mannose glycans on envelope glycoproteins facilitate viral entry and provide a glycan shield to evade host antibodies (Source: Nature Communications, 11, 4304). Therapeutically, these carbohydrates are targeted by lectins and engineered proteins to promote opsonization, trigger complement activation, or directly neutralize pathogens by blocking their attachment to host cells (Source: Marine Drugs, 17(12), 667). Understanding the density and branching of these mannose structures is vital for developing novel antifungal treatments, antiviral microbicides, and diagnostic assays for systemic infections.
Binding to terminal mannose residues on microbial surfaces to induce opsonization, activate the lectin complement pathway, or sterically hinder viral entry into host cells (Source: Frontiers in Immunology, 2020; DOI: 10.3389/fimmu.2020.01646).
